Confusing Arteries and Veins

This is a graeco-roman error. Remember: A rteries carry blood A way from the heart. Veins carry blood T oward the heart. Furthermore, arteries usually carry oxygenated blood (except for the pulmonary artery), while veins usually carry deoxygenated blood (except for the pulmonary vein). Paired with this is the difference in vessel thickness—arteries have thicker walls to withstand the force of pumping, while veins have valves to prevent backflow.

Mixing Up Skeletal and Muscular Structures

It befall all the clip. Don't confuse a sinew (connects muscle to cram) with a ligament (connects os to ivory). Also, don't mix up the scapula (shoulder blade) with the collarbone (clavicle). The humerus is the upper arm bone, while the femoris is the thigh bone. These differentiation affair.
